What if a patient needs to speak to someone urgently about their treatment outside of clinic hours?
If a patient feels unwell as a result of their on-going treatment or if they have a question about their treatment that needs an immediate answer, they should call 01922 455911 at any time, any day of the year. Out of office hours a message will give the patient a mobile number of a senior member of the MFS team who will deal with any concerns. Please note that these calls will be taken outside of the office and so patient notes will not be available to refer to, and the diary will not be available to book appointments. Calls are taken via a mobile phone and so may be disturbed by background noise, although every effort is made to keep this to a minimum.
